Frequently Asked Questions About Water Heater Repair in Archbald, PA

Yes! Tankless water heaters heat water on demand, saving 25% to 40% on energy costs while freeing up valuable square footage. They eliminate standby heat loss and provide a continuous, endless supply of hot water for large households.
Yes. Converting requires evaluating your gas line diameter or electrical service panel capacity, rerouting water supply lines, and installing proper direct venting. Our specialists handle the entire conversion seamlessly.
A tripped breaker typically signifies a burned-out heating element whose protective casing has cracked, causing an electrical short to ground inside the tank. It can also stem from a malfunctioning high-limit thermostat switch.
Direct vent units vent combustion gases naturally through a vertical chimney or B-vent flue. Power vent units use an electric fan motor to push exhaust horizontally through PVC or polypropylene pipes out a sidewall.
A typical family of 4 to 5 requires a 50-gallon gas water heater or a 55 to 80-gallon electric tank (or a tankless unit producing 7.5 to 9.5 gallons per minute) to ensure sufficient first-hour hot water capacity.
